Janet Richards.
Stood for Green Party of England and Wales in New Forest West at the 2017 General Election. Not elected — so there is no parliamentary record to show, but here is the contest in full and where the seat stands now.
Finished 4th of 5 with 1,454 votes (2.9%).
The result in full · 2017 General Election
| Candidate | Party | Votes | Share |
|---|---|---|---|
| Desmond Swayne✓ elected | Con | 33,170 | 66.8% |
| Jo Graham | Lab | 9,739 | 19.6% |
| Terry Scriven | LD | 4,781 | 9.6% |
| Janet Richards | Green | 1,454 | 2.9% |
| Des Hjerling | — | 483 | 1.0% |
Majority 23,431 · 49,627 votes cast.
The seat now
New Forest West is represented by Desmond Swayne (Con), who won this contest.
